Detailed Description

This class if responsible for the map format. It tries to abstract most if not all calls to the underlying HDF5 API and the HighFive wrapper. Furthermore it ensures the defined map format is always in place and not tinkered with.

NOTE: the map file is held open for the whole live time of this object. Thus it is possible that some data is only written to disc if the destructor is called or the program has ended. Also make sure the map file is not opened in any other way. (i.e. with the HDF5 Viewer). This will always lead to errors trying to access the file.

◆ removeAllLabels()

bool hdf5_map_io::HDF5MapIO::removeAllLabels ( )

Removes all labels from the file.
Be careful, this does not clear up the space of the labels. Use the cli tool 'h5repack' manually to clear up all wasted space if this method was used multiple times.

Returns
true if removing all labels successfully.
